createssh - An Overview
createssh - An Overview
Blog Article
When a shopper makes an attempt to authenticate utilizing SSH keys, the server can examination the client on whether or not they are in possession with the private critical. In the event the client can verify that it owns the non-public crucial, a shell session is spawned or the requested command is executed.
Open up your ~/.ssh/config file, then modify the file to have the subsequent traces. If your SSH critical file has a different title or route than the example code, modify the filename or route to match your present set up.
Deliver a ssh vital pair conveniently to be used with a variety of companies like SSH , SFTP , Github and so forth. This Instrument utilizes OpenSSL to produce KeyPairs. If you want to acquire password authentication to suit your needs your keys make sure you provide a password , else a go away it empty for no passphrase .
Visualize that my laptop computer breaks or I really need to format it how am i able to use of the server if my nearby ssh keys was ruined.
The central idea is usually that as an alternative to a password, 1 takes advantage of a crucial file that is just about not possible to guess. You give the general public part of the vital, and when logging in, Will probably be utilized, together with the non-public important and username, to createssh verify your identity.
Warning: In case you have Formerly created a critical pair, you can be prompted to confirm that you truly desire to overwrite the existing vital:
You will end up requested to enter precisely the same passphrase once more to verify that you have typed what you assumed you experienced typed.
ssh-keygen is really a command-line Device utilized to deliver, handle, and convert SSH keys. It means that you can create secure authentication credentials for distant entry. You could find out more about ssh-keygen And exactly how it really works in How to Create SSH Keys with OpenSSH on macOS or Linux.
Our recommendation is to collect randomness through the total set up of the operating program, preserve that randomness in the random seed file. Then boot the technique, acquire some far more randomness in the boot, blend during the saved randomness with the seed file, and only then crank out the host keys.
Make sure you can remotely connect with, and log into, the distant Pc. This proves that your user title and password have a valid account create about the distant Laptop and that your qualifications are correct.
Since the private crucial isn't subjected to the community which is shielded via file permissions, this file must under no circumstances be obtainable to any one other than you (and the root user). The passphrase serves as an additional layer of protection in case these circumstances are compromised.
Repeat the method for the non-public essential. You may also established a passphrase to secure the keys additionally.
An improved Answer is to automate incorporating keys, retailer passwords, and to specify which critical to utilize when accessing certain servers.
When making SSH keys beneath Linux, You should use the ssh-keygen command. It's really a Device for making new authentication vital pairs for SSH.